Dedicated to Captain Thomas Hammon Miller 1947-2006 Thomas H. Miller was born in Sacramento California on October 10, 1947. He went to Vietnam when he was 20, and served in the USMC. One of the men he was put into a squad with asked, "hey buddy you got 20\20 vision?", Miller replied, "ya I got it", the man said to him ,"ok then you're on point!". He served 2 tours in Vietnam(67-69) as a Captain, and recieved the Medal of Honor and the Purple Heart.He was known by his buddies as "Tomcat".But thats not all, he also met the love of his life in Vietnam, who he soon married and she became Sharon Miller. Thomas Miller enjoyed fishing, going to the shooting rang,and most of all, spending time with his family. He also enjoyed a camping trip here and there. One of his famous sayings was: "It doesn't take one man to get it done, it takes men!" Qote from Sharon Miller: "Thomas was a man of pride, dignity and courage! There wasn't one thing that man would'nt do for another fellow individual! And how I loved him." Thomas Hammon Miller passed away on April 17,2006 at the age of 58. He left behind a loving wife of 40 yrs, Sharon Miller,and a loving family, 2 daughters, Alice and Christa Miller, 2 sons, Sam and Adrian Miller.
